我尝试在本地主机上运行pdf.js示例,在下载之后我做到了
make server
但是,当我尝试运行与下载捆绑在一起的示例时,我得到了这个错误
missing variable name
var in = i * n;
http://localhost/pdf.js/src/function.js
Line 174
成功获取PDF文件
GET http://localhost/pdf.js/examples/helloworld/helloworld.pdf 200 OK 210ms
作为一项要求,我是否遗漏了什么?
我正在尝试编写一个chrome扩展来实现PDFJS从PDF中提取数据。我可以在读取本地文件时实现这一点,但我希望在浏览器中解析当前正在查看的PDF。
我收到了大量的以下错误:
'Warning: Ignoring invalid character "33" in hex string'
'Warning: Ignoring invalid character "79" in hex string'...
然后
"Error
at InvalidPDFExceptionClosure (chrome-extensi
我正在开发一个从Michael Beale 发布的示例开始的PDF查看器。它可以很好地处理大量不同类型的文档。我的问题是,加载不止一次由TEKLA导出为PDF的2d模型,第一次运行良好,但以下失败在控制台上显示错误:
font-engine.js:51 Failed to map font Arial
value @ font-engine.js:51
value @ font-engine.js:59
value @ LmvCanvasContext.js:594
paintChar @ pdf.js:11506
showText @ pdf.js:11635
executeOperator
API 30引入了与WebView中的文件访问相关的更改。
/**
* Enables or disables file access within WebView.
* Note that this enables or disables file system access only. Assets and reso
这是PDF.js站点
https://github.com/mozilla/pdf.js
我正在搜索和阅读大量文章,大部分编码都是将pdf导入pdf.js并在浏览器上显示,我无法理解PDF.js是否能够在不下载pdf文件的情况下在web浏览器上创建PDF格式和显示?
这是我找到的示例代码:
'use strict';
//
// Fetch the PDF document from the URL using promises
//
PDFJS.getDocument('helloworld.pdf').then(function(pdf) {
// U
当我使用html-pdf节点模块从HTML文件生成PDF时,它抛出以下错误(仅在docker中)。同样的代码可以在本地机器ubuntu 18.04中运行
write EPIPE\n at afterWriteDispatched (internal/stream_base_commons.js:154:25)\n at writeGeneric (internal/stream_base_commons.js:145:3)\n at Socket._writeGeneric (net.js:784:11)\n at Socket._write (net.js:796:
我正在使用PDF.js库在我的站点中显示PDf文件(使用pdf_viewer.js在屏幕上显示文档),但是我正在显示的PDF文件是机密的,我需要能够在站点内显示它们,但阻止未经授权的公众能够通过键入URL并看到它们在浏览器中显示来查看相同的文件。
我试图在htaccess文件中添加Deny from all行,但courfse也阻止了查看器显示文档,所以这似乎是行不通的。显然,任何人都可以简单地查看inspector,并看到查看者正在读取的pdf文件,因此似乎直接的URL不会以任何方式安全。
我确实读到过PDF.js能够读取二进制数据,但我不知道如何在我自己的文件系统中读取PDF,并为库使用准
我正在尝试开发一个使用Sencha和Cordova的移动设备应用程序。由于安卓浏览器不支持PDf,我决定使用PDF.JS,它在加载本地PDf文件时运行良好,但是当尝试打开远程文件时,它抛出了一个错误
http://<remote server pdf location>. Origin file:// is not allowed by Access-Control-Allow-Origin
请让我知道如何解决这个问题。有没有办法解决这个问题在PDF.JS。我只需要本地的PDF.Js文件,因为该应用程序也需要离线能力。
提前感谢
我有一个关于PDF.js和CORS配置的问题。
我从域A将PDF.js加载到iframe中,参数为文件(服务器的完整路径,它将返回一个pdf文档)。PDF.js将使用origin: domain A向域B中的服务器创建请求。域B上的服务器返回标题为Access-Control-Allow-Origin: domain A的pdf文档,到目前为止一切正常。
在我的网络选项卡中,我看到对服务器的请求,它返回一个200 status OK,但PDF.js抛出了一个错误Unexpected server response (0) while retrieving PDF <url>。
问题